Ham, Broccoli, and Cheddar Quiche Recipe: A Family Favorite

A golden, flaky crust filled with tender broccoli, diced ham, and sharp cheddar cheese in a creamy egg custard. This versatile quiche is equally impressive for special occasions and easy weeknight meals!

Ingredients

Scale
  • For Crust:
  • 1 9-inch pie crust (homemade or store-bought)
  • 1 egg white, lightly beaten (for blind baking)
  • For Filling:
  • 1 cup diced cooked ham
  • 1 cup small broccoli florets, blanched
  • 1½ cups sh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• ½ tsp salt
  • ¼ tsp black pepper
  • ¼ tsp ground nutmeg
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ard

Instructions

  1. Prep crust: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Roll out crust and fit into 9-inch pie dish. Prick bottom with fork, line with parchment, and fill with pie weights. Blind bake 15 minutes. Remove weights, brush with egg white, bake 5 more minutes.
  2. Prepare filling: Sprinkle ham, broccoli, and cheese evenly in par-baked crust.
  3. Make custard: Whisk eggs, milk, cream, salt, pepper, nutmeg, and mustard until smooth.
  4. Assemble: Pour custard over fillings. Gently stir with fork to distribute ingredients.
  5. Bake: Bake 35-45 minutes until center is set (knife inserted comes out clean).
  6. Cool: Let rest 10 minutes before slicing.

Notes

  • For crispier crust: Brush with egg white after blind baking
  • Vegetarian option: Omit ham, add sautéed mushrooms
  • Make ahead: Par-bake crust and prep fillings 1 day in advance
  • Storage: Keeps refrigerated 3 days – reheat at 300°F (150°C) for 15 minutes
  • Serving suggestion: Pair with mixed greens and vinaigrette
